noteDigger:终极免费的音乐扒谱工具完整指南
在音乐创作的世界里,扒谱一直是一项既专业又耗时的工作。noteDigger作为一款纯前端的智能音乐扒谱工具,彻底改变了这一现状。这款开源工具不仅完全免费,而且操作简单快捷,让每个人都能轻松将音频转换为标准乐谱。
🎵 快速上手:三步开始音乐扒谱
使用noteDigger进行音乐扒谱异常简单,只需三个步骤就能开启创作之旅:
第一步:导入音频文件 支持MP3、WAV、MP4等常见格式,直接拖拽文件到界面即可完成上传。这种直观的操作方式大大降低了使用门槛,即使是音乐新手也能立即上手。
第二步:智能频谱分析
工具会自动对音频进行深度分析,通过先进的FFT算法提取频率信息。你可以在dataProcess/analyser.js和dataProcess/fft_real.js中看到核心处理逻辑的实现。
第三步:绘制与调整音符 根据频谱分析结果,在时间轴上自由添加和编辑音符,实时播放对比,确保扒谱结果的准确性。
🎹 核心功能详解
智能频谱分析引擎
noteDigger内置强大的音频处理引擎,能够精确捕捉音频中的每一个音符。通过dataProcess/AI/目录下的机器学习模型,工具实现了音色无关的智能转录,大大提升了扒谱效率。
多音轨编辑系统
支持同时处理多个音轨,每个音轨都可以独立编辑和调整。channelDiv.js模块负责构建直观的多音轨界面,让复杂的音乐编排变得简单易行。
实时播放与同步
内置的tinySynth.js合成器提供128种音色选择,确保扒谱过程中的实时反馈和精准同步。
🔧 实用操作技巧
常用快捷键汇总
- 空格键:播放/暂停
- 双击时间轴:从指定位置开始播放
- Ctrl+Z:撤销操作
- Ctrl+C/V:复制粘贴音符
- Delete键:删除选中音符
音符绘制技巧
- 按住空白区域拖动创建新音符
- 拖动音符左侧调整位置
- 拖动音符右侧调整时长
- 中键拖动移动视野范围
📁 项目架构优势
noteDigger采用纯前端解决方案,所有计算都在浏览器中完成。这种设计不仅保护了用户隐私,还确保了工具的运行效率。
核心模块分布:
app.js:主程序入口app_analyser.js:时频分析核心app_midiplayer.js:MIDI播放控制app_spectrogram.js:频谱图显示
🎯 实际应用场景
音乐教育领域
教师可以使用noteDigger作为教学工具,帮助学生理解音乐结构和扒谱原理。工具的直观界面让抽象的音乐理论变得具体可见。
个人音乐创作
音乐爱好者能够快速将灵感旋律转换为标准乐谱,大大缩短了创作周期。无论是简单的旋律还是复杂的编曲,noteDigger都能轻松应对。
专业音乐制作
制作人可以利用工具进行快速的乐谱转换,专注于创意表达而非技术细节。
💡 使用建议与最佳实践
-
音频选择:推荐使用高质量的MP3或WAV文件,确保分析结果的准确性。
-
分析设置:根据音乐类型调整分析参数,获得最佳的扒谱效果。
-
导出优化:利用小节对齐功能,确保导出的MIDI文件能够直接用于专业制谱软件。
🚀 技术特色亮点
noteDigger的最大特色在于其完全自主开发的技术架构。项目不使用任何外部框架或库,所有功能都是原生JavaScript实现。这种设计理念不仅保证了代码的轻量化,还确保了运行的高效性。
工具还引入了人工智能扒谱功能,在dataProcess/AI/basicamt.js中实现了基于神经网络的智能音符识别,虽然效果仍在优化中,但已经展现出巨大的潜力。
无论是专业音乐人还是业余爱好者,noteDigger都提供了一个简单、高效、免费的扒谱解决方案。通过不断的技术迭代和功能优化,这款工具正在成为音乐创作领域的重要助力。
Kimi-K2.5Kimi K2.5 是一款开源的原生多模态智能体模型,它在 Kimi-K2-Base 的基础上,通过对约 15 万亿混合视觉和文本 tokens 进行持续预训练构建而成。该模型将视觉与语言理解、高级智能体能力、即时模式与思考模式,以及对话式与智能体范式无缝融合。Python00- QQwen3-Coder-Next2026年2月4日,正式发布的Qwen3-Coder-Next,一款专为编码智能体和本地开发场景设计的开源语言模型。Python00
xw-cli实现国产算力大模型零门槛部署,一键跑通 Qwen、GLM-4.7、Minimax-2.1、DeepSeek-OCR 等模型Go06
PaddleOCR-VL-1.5PaddleOCR-VL-1.5 是 PaddleOCR-VL 的新一代进阶模型,在 OmniDocBench v1.5 上实现了 94.5% 的全新 state-of-the-art 准确率。 为了严格评估模型在真实物理畸变下的鲁棒性——包括扫描伪影、倾斜、扭曲、屏幕拍摄和光照变化——我们提出了 Real5-OmniDocBench 基准测试集。实验结果表明,该增强模型在新构建的基准测试集上达到了 SOTA 性能。此外,我们通过整合印章识别和文本检测识别(text spotting)任务扩展了模型的能力,同时保持 0.9B 的超紧凑 VLM 规模,具备高效率特性。Python00
KuiklyUI基于KMP技术的高性能、全平台开发框架,具备统一代码库、极致易用性和动态灵活性。 Provide a high-performance, full-platform development framework with unified codebase, ultimate ease of use, and dynamic flexibility. 注意:本仓库为Github仓库镜像,PR或Issue请移步至Github发起,感谢支持!Kotlin08
VLOOKVLOOK™ 是优雅好用的 Typora/Markdown 主题包和增强插件。 VLOOK™ is an elegant and practical THEME PACKAGE × ENHANCEMENT PLUGIN for Typora/Markdown.Less00
